Notes: {'Caller': 1, 'LanguageCode': 'en', 'LastEdited': '', 'LastEditedBy': '', 'References': [], 'Content': 'It may be of interest to note that in Greek NT manuscripts καθάπερ and καθώσπερ are often alternative forms. As in the case of ὥσπερ and ὡσπερεί ({D:64.13}) in contrast with ὡς[a] and ὡσεί[a] ({D:64.12}), so καθάπερ and καθώσπερ appear to be somewhat more emphatic than καθά and καθώς[c] ({D:64.14}).'}
